Lord Caine Portrait Lord Caine (Con)
- Hansard - - - Excerpts

My Lords, on Saturday, my right honourable friend the Secretary of State for Northern Ireland told the Belfast News Letter that people in Northern Ireland are part of the United Kingdom and should enjoy the same products as people in the rest of the United Kingdom. I wholeheartedly support that position. Does my noble friend therefore agree that if the operation of the protocol is preventing that from happening, urgent change is required? Does she further agree that it is now EU intransigence on this subject that is destabilising the position in Northern Ireland and undermining unionist confidence in the Belfast agreement?

Baroness Scott of Bybrook Portrait Baroness Scott of Bybrook (Con)
- Hansard - -

My noble friend is absolutely right. We need to respond to the outstanding concerns of the protocol, but we must be able to command confidence across the whole community, and that is why we have set out the need to take forward work here in the Joint Committee. All sides must take account of the political sensitivities and the realities on the ground.
